'Big Brother' star barred from town's pubs
Published Friday, Oct 16 2009, 10:11 BST | By Rebecca Davies
Former Australian Big Brother housemate Rory Ammon has been barred from going into any pubs or clubs in Geelong for at least three months after allegedly assaulting police.
Officers reportedly had to use pepper spray on Ammon, who was was apparently drunk and aggressive towards a female taxi driver.
Sergeant Tony Francis told the Geelong Advertiser: "He refused to give his details, stating that police should know who he was. He was subsequently arrested for offensive behaviour, offensive language and failing to state his name and address."
Police apparently arrested and handcuffed the 23-year-old but he was sprayed with the defensive spray when he lashed out with his legs and refused to get into their vehicle.
Ammon, who described the officers' behaviour as "barbaric and uncalled for", said yesterday: "The police definitely took things too far... I think it's wrong for them to try and make a spectacle out of me in front of the rest of Geelong."
